Nigerian citizens have united to protest police brutality in their country. However, their peaceful protests have gone tragically violent as police have killed Nigerian protesters.

According to BCC, the youth of Nigeria has been taking initiative sharing their disapproval and anger towards the Special Anti Robbery Squad (SARS) police unit, which has resulted in lotting, kidnappings, and harassment.

Since the breaking news of the protests in Nigeria, celebrities like Rihanna, Nicki Minaj and Karrueche have taken to social media to express their solidarity.

“I can’t bare to see this torture and brutalization that is continuing to affect nations across our planet!” RiRi wrote on Twitter. “It’s such a betrayal to the citizens, the very people put in place to protect are the ones we are most afraid of being murdered by!”

“My heart is broken for Nigeria man!! It is unbearable to watch! I’m so proud of your strength and not letting up on the fight for what’s right! #ENDSARS.," Rihanna added.
